2 months ago i had my tests done. My tsh level was 6. With total t3 , total t4 and anti tpo normal. I will repeat my test next month. I am confuse should i test free t3 and free t4 along with tsh or total t3 and t4. What tests should i repeat with tsh?

I wouldn't recommend testing right now. You can repeat the TFTs (Thyroid Function Tests) in 6 months' time, starting with a TSH (Thyroid-Stimulating Hormone) test. What were your symptoms, and why did you have these tests done?
